An extremely common "screw up" when stoking up a muzzleloading rifle is to seat a projectile, patched ball or bullet, down the bore - WITHOUT first dropping in a charge of powder. If you have inadvertently loaded a ball without first loading a powder charge, you must remove the breech plug with the breech plug wrench and push the ball from the barrel (See "To Unload", p. 20) before starting all over again. To remove a charge from your T/C Encore muzzleloader it will be necessary to take the following steps: 1st Step - Tip the barrel open and make sure that the gun is unprimed.
